Kingston is a brand that produces memory products, such as SD cards, USB drives, and memory modules. The company is headquartered in Fountain Valley, California, and was founded in 1987. Kingston is a well-known and trusted brand in the memory industry, and offers a wide range of products to meet the needs of consumers and businesses.
